Overview

Job Description Working closely with the Market-based Population Health teams, primary care providers (PCP’s), networked partners, and operations team at Privia Health, the Clinical Quality Associate will provide ownership and execution on defined Value-Based Care program performance metrics and support for Privia’s at-risk patients within a defined region. Primary work will include completing quality audits, providing context for provider education, patient outreach to provide coordination services, fill gaps in care, payer attestations, and regular review and action on local performance reports and regional action plans.

The candidate will have relevant clinical experience, educational background or license/certification to support the Quality Management team.
